38*cdf0e10cSrcweir /** @descr
39*cdf0e10cSrcweir     Is able to parse an XML file with Component descriptions. Gives access
40*cdf0e10cSrcweir     to the parsed data.
41*cdf0e10cSrcweir 
42*cdf0e10cSrcweir     Use:
43*cdf0e10cSrcweir         CompDescrsFromAnXmlFile aCds;
44*cdf0e10cSrcweir         UniString aFilepath(...);
45*cdf0e10cSrcweir         if (! aCds.Parse(aFilepath) )
46*cdf0e10cSrcweir         {
47*cdf0e10cSrcweir             // react on:
48*cdf0e10cSrcweir             aCds.Status();
49*cdf0e10cSrcweir         }
50*cdf0e10cSrcweir 
51*cdf0e10cSrcweir         With operator[] you get access to ComponentDescriptions
52*cdf0e10cSrcweir         on indices 0 to NrOfDescriptions()-1 .
53*cdf0e10cSrcweir 
54*cdf0e10cSrcweir         For further handling see class ComponentDescription
55*cdf0e10cSrcweir         in xml_cd.hxx .
56*cdf0e10cSrcweir 
57*cdf0e10cSrcweir         It is possible to parse more than one time. Then the old data
58*cdf0e10cSrcweir         are discarded.
59*cdf0e10cSrcweir **/
60*cdf0e10cSrcweir class CompDescrsFromAnXmlFile
61*cdf0e10cSrcweir {
62*cdf0e10cSrcweir   public:
63*cdf0e10cSrcweir     enum E_Status
64*cdf0e10cSrcweir     {
65*cdf0e10cSrcweir         ok = 0,
66*cdf0e10cSrcweir         not_yet_parsed,
67*cdf0e10cSrcweir         cant_read_file,
68*cdf0e10cSrcweir         inconsistent_file,
69*cdf0e10cSrcweir         no_tag_found_in_file
70*cdf0e10cSrcweir     };
71*cdf0e10cSrcweir 
72*cdf0e10cSrcweir     //  LIFECYCLE
73*cdf0e10cSrcweir                         CompDescrsFromAnXmlFile();
74*cdf0e10cSrcweir                         ~CompDescrsFromAnXmlFile();
75*cdf0e10cSrcweir 
76*cdf0e10cSrcweir     //  OPERATIONS
77*cdf0e10cSrcweir     BOOL                Parse(
78*cdf0e10cSrcweir                             const UniString &   i_sXmlFilePath );
79*cdf0e10cSrcweir 
80*cdf0e10cSrcweir     //  INQUIRY
81*cdf0e10cSrcweir     INT32               NrOfDescriptions() const;
82*cdf0e10cSrcweir     const ComponentDescription &
83*cdf0e10cSrcweir                         operator[](             /// @return an empty description, if index does not exist.
84*cdf0e10cSrcweir                             INT32               i_nIndex ) const;
85*cdf0e10cSrcweir     CompDescrsFromAnXmlFile::E_Status
86*cdf0e10cSrcweir                         Status() const;
87*cdf0e10cSrcweir 
88*cdf0e10cSrcweir   private:
89*cdf0e10cSrcweir     // PRIVATE SERVICES
90*cdf0e10cSrcweir     void                Empty();
91*cdf0e10cSrcweir 
92*cdf0e10cSrcweir     // DATA
93*cdf0e10cSrcweir     std::vector< ComponentDescriptionImpl* >    *
94*cdf0e10cSrcweir                         dpDescriptions;
95*cdf0e10cSrcweir     E_Status            eStatus;
96*cdf0e10cSrcweir };
